TopGolf, Addlestone, Surrey, 01932 858551 TopGolf is a fun point scoring game offering players a great way of getting started in golf, improving golf skills and having fun! TopGolf is played at a state-of-the-art golf driving range, using real golf balls, real golf tees and real golf clubs, on a real driving range, but more sophisticated! A microchip inside each golf ball at provides instant feedback to a screen in each player’s bay about how far the ball was hit and the accuracy of each shot. There are 48 covered bays and 11 targets to aim for. There is also a 9-hole par 3 course.

| Brooklands Museum, Weybridge, Surrey, 01932 857381 Brooklands dates back to 1907, and has since built up an impressive history in motor sport, motorcycles and aviation, and now houses the motor sport and aviation museum. Brooklands can boost many firsts including having the world's first purpose built motor racing circuit. There are 30 aircrafts on site, displaying the story of aviation, and a Concorde is also on view here. |
| Rural Life Centre, Tilford, 01252 795571 The museum of past village life is set in 10 acres of garden and woodlands, incorporating 160 years of farming from 1800 to 1960. Purpose-built and reconstructed historical rural buildings are on view and include a chapel, village hall, cricket pavilion, and school room. Also to see is the Arboretum with 100 species of tree. |
| Guildford Museum, Guildford, Surrey, 01483 444750 The museum was founded in 1898 and is housed in a 17th century building beside Guildford Castle. Housed in the museum is the largest collection of archaeology, local history and needlework in Surrey. Regular exhibitions are held and there are children’s activities. |
| Guildford House Gallery, Guildford, Surrey, 01483 444740 Historic building dating back to the 17th century, that is now an art gallery. House features include decorated plaster ceilings, wrought iron balcony, panelled rooms and an ornately carved oak and elm staircase. Art Exhibitions are held here throughout the year. |
